"Navigating the Complex Landscape of Data Governance: Practices and Strategies"
?governance refers to the set of processes, policies, standards, and practices that ensure the effective and secure management of an organization's data assets. It involves defining the rules and responsibilities for data quality, security, privacy, accessibility, and usage throughout the data lifecycle. The primary goal of data governance is to establish a framework that enables consistent, reliable, and compliant management of data across the organization.
Core Capabilities:
Master??management (MDM) is a technology-enabled discipline in which business and IT work together to ensure the uniformity, accuracy, stewardship, semantic consistency, and accountability of the enterprise's official shared master data assets.
MDM helps improve the quality of an organization's data by ensuring that identifiers and other key data elements about those entities are accurate and consistent, enterprise-wide.
Importance of MDM:
-?It helps businesses get a consolidated view of the data scattered across the organization
- It reduces redundancy, every piece of master data is collected only once.
- It reduces the workload in business departments due to the reduced or eliminated effort to maintain master data independently
- Act as a Single Source of Truth. A source that provides all relevant master data and directly leads to the benefit of superior data quality. Data quality in this context isn’t only about the correct data but also the most up-to-date.
- Defined Governance process: Master data in one central place enables companies to set up dedicated data compliance and governance processes.?
- Reduce TTM
Business initiatives addressed by MDM include:
? Customer experience
??Analytics
? Mergers and acquisitions
? Governance and compliance
? Operational efficiency
? Supplier optimization
??Product?experience
Metadata management?is the discipline of managing the metadata about data. It gives meaning and describes the information assets in your organization. Metadata unlocks the value of your data by improving data’s usability and findability. Metadata provides the context required to understand and govern your systems, your data, and your business. By using metadata management, it is easier to find and use data and provide the critical data context your business and??teams require. Metadata management platforms help ensure that data is well understood, easily discoverable, and effectively utilized by both technical and non-technical stakeholders.
Metadata management is a cross-organizational agreement on how to define informational assets for converting data into an enterprise asset. As??volumes and diversity grow, metadata management is even more critical to deriving business value from gigantic amounts of data.?
Why do companies need metadata management:
- Discover data
- Understand data relationships
- Track how data is used
- Assess the value and risks associated with data usage
Key features and benefits of metadata management platform:
- Centralized Repository: These platforms provide a single, centralized repository where metadata from various sources can be stored. This enables users to access consistent and up-to-date metadata information in one location
- Metadata Capture: Allows users to capture metadata automatically from various systems, applications, and databases. This metadata could include data lineage (how data moves and transforms), data definitions, business rules, data owners, and more
- Data Discovery and Exploration: Users can search, browse, and explore metadata to understand the structure and relationships of data assets. This aids in finding the right data for analysis and decision-making.
- Data Lineage: Often include visual representations of data lineage, showing how data flows from source to destination through various transformations and processes.
- Collaboration: Users can contribute to and collaborate on metadata by adding comments, tags, and annotations, enhancing the understanding and context of data.
- Impact Analysis: Enable users to analyze the potential impact of changes to data structures, processes, or systems before implementing those changes.
- Data Quality: Metadata about data quality rules and metrics can be stored, helping to monitor and maintain data quality standards
- Regulatory Compliance: Aids in regulatory compliance by capturing metadata related to data privacy, security, and regulatory requirements.
- Integration: Often integrate with other data-related tools and systems, such as data integration, data cataloging, and business intelligence solutions.
Data Catalogs are the new black in data management and analytics -> Gartner Research
A???is a centralized repository or database that provides metadata about the available data assets within an organization. It serves as a tool to help individuals discover, understand, and access various data sources, datasets, databases, tables, files, and other data-related resources. Data catalogs play a crucial role in data management, data governance, and data collaboration within businesses and organizations.
It serves as an organized data inventory for all data sources. It enables data search and discovery of data assets, with the right context.
Moreover, data catalogs built for the modern data stack can trace lineage and help set up granular access policies and permissions. This enables better data security and compliance with various data protection regulations and privacy laws.
Benefits of Data Catalogue:
1. Metadata Management: Explained above
2. Data Discovery: Users can search and explore the data catalog to find relevant data assets for their needs. This saves time by avoiding the need to manually locate and verify datasets.
3. Data Lineage: Data catalogs often include lineage information, showing the origins and transformations of data as it moves through various stages of processing. This is crucial for understanding data quality and reliability.
4. Collaboration: Data catalogs facilitate collaboration among data professionals, allowing them to share insights, annotations, and comments about specific datasets, improving data understanding and usability.
5. Self-Service Analytics: Data catalogs enable self-service analytics by empowering users to find and use data assets for their analysis and reporting without extensive assistance from IT teams.
6. Data Catalog Automation: Some advanced data catalogs use automation and machine learning to categorize, tag, and recommend relevant datasets based on user behavior and data relationships.
7. Impact Analysis: Data catalog tools can help users understand the potential impact of changes to datasets, helping them make informed decisions about updates or modifications.
?Security and??play a pivotal role in data governance solutions.
Security standards can make or break your deals. Enterprises are more concerned about the security of data. It helps ensure that sensitive information is properly protected and managed so no one can have unauthorized access to the information.
Some of the key solutions that can be implemented:
?Data Classification: Data Architecture needs to classify the sensitivity of the data. This will lead to strict security measures and controls. Different classifications can have different access controls, encryption requirements, and handling guidelines.
?Policy Management: Define policies on how different types of data should be handled, stored, accessed, and shared. These policies should align with regulations and best practices.
? Role-Based Access Controls (RBAC): It's one of the ways to control access. Control the data access at the row level, and share only the necessary information with the data consumers. This reduces the risk of unauthorized access, and helps the admin to set up an easy process to provide access control.
? Data Masking and Anonymization: Sensitize your data, while sharing data with the developers or analytics team, encrypting the sensitive info share only what is needed for their purpose.
? Encryption: Implement encryption for both data at rest and data in transit. This ensures that even if data is accessed or intercepted, it remains unreadable without the appropriate decryption keys.
? Consent Management: If your organization collects and processes personal data, implement a consent management system to track and manage user consent in compliance with privacy regulations.
? Data Retention and Deletion Policies: Define clear guidelines for how long different types of data should be retained and when they should be securely deleted. This helps reduce the risk of retaining unnecessary data that could be vulnerable to breaches. Make sure you clearly specify the data withhold information and delete data from all your active system within the stipulated time period.
? Auditing and Monitoring: Implement robust auditing and monitoring mechanisms to track data access, changes, and activities. This enables the detection of unauthorized or suspicious behavior in real time.
? Data Sharing Agreements: When sharing data externally or with partners, establish clear data sharing agreements that outline how the data will be used, protected, and managed by the recipient.
? Data Governance Committees: Establish committees or teams responsible for overseeing data security and privacy aspects within the data governance framework. These teams can ensure compliance, address issues, and drive continuous improvement.
? Training and Awareness: Provide regular training to employees about data security and privacy best practices. A well-informed workforce is crucial for maintaining a strong security posture.
Data?quality?measures how well a?dataset?meets criteria for accuracy, completeness, validity, consistency, uniqueness, timeliness, and fitness for purpose, and it is critical to all data governance initiatives within an organization.
Data quality assessments are executed by data quality analysts, who assess and interpret each individual data quality metric, aggregate a score for the overall quality of the data, and provide organizations with a percentage to represent the accuracy of their data. A low data quality scorecard indicates poor data quality, which is of low value, is misleading and can lead to poor decision-making that may harm the organization.
feature of Data Quality:
-> Accuracy:?The data should reflect actual, real-world scenarios; the measure of accuracy can be confirmed with a verifiable source.
-> Completeness:?Completeness is a measure of the data’s ability to effectively deliver all the required values that are available.
-> Consistency:?Data consistency refers to the?uniformity of data as it moves across networks and applications. The same data values stored in different locations should not conflict with one another.??
-> Validity:?Data should be collected according to defined business rules and parameters, and should conform to the right format and fall within the right range.???
-> Uniqueness:?Uniqueness ensures there are no duplications or overlapping of values across all data sets. Data cleansing and deduplication can help remedy a low uniqueness score.
-> Timeliness:?Timely data is data that is available when it is required. Data may be updated in real-time to ensure that it is readily available and accessible.
Data quality issues can arise from various sources, including manual data entry errors, system glitches, data integration challenges, and more. Addressing data quality requires a combination of proper data governance, quality assurance processes, automated validation, and ongoing monitoring. Organizations that prioritize data quality can enhance decision-making, improve customer experiences, and optimize business processes.
Popular vendors that offer data governance solutions include?Informatica,?Collibra,?Talend,?IBM,?SAP,?Alation, and many others. When selecting a data governance solution, organizations should consider their specific requirements, integration needs, scalability, user-friendliness, and alignment with their overall data governance strategy.
Image source: egnyte, alation and others